I have two folders visible in my desktop but not in the folder desktop (personal folder and trash), they were there when I installed Ubuntu.
Some days ago I've added two .txt files on the desktop folder.

Theses two files don't open when I double click, select and press Enter, or right click and select "open". To open them from the desktop, I have to right click, select "open with another application", then it opens a window and I select my program.

After doing it two times and execute ubuntu-bug, select "open with..." don't open anymore the window but opens directly the file with the program I've selected before (it acts like "open").

To pinpoint the problem, I've copied two new .txt files, one with nautilus and one with right click on the desktop. Theses new files open normally, with double click or select and Enter.

So the two other files are kind of locked...

I am not sure if the problem comes from xdg-desktop-portal package, but I could not find a better package...
